Just switched from an old version of ACDSee to XnView.
However, I have some trouble with rotated JPEGs, maybe someone here could help me?
JPEGs that I rotated within ACDSee but which contain an EXIF information appear unrotated within the XnView thumbnail display. The preview and the full screen view show the real picture (rotated, as it is).
It seems that ACDSee did not interpret and change the EXIF information and now this information does not match the real rotation / orientation of the picture, so XnView cannot display the thumbnail correctly.
How can I correct this?
I tried rotating the JPEGs within XnView, but it also rotates the preview, so the difference between the real picture and the preview remains (but both rotated 90 degrees)...
